Matheson Wetlands Preserve - Main Pond & Boardwalk is a productive birding destination in Utah, with 215 species recorded on eBird. This lake habitat attracts Canada Goose, Sandhill Crane, and Northern Harrier among many others. When is the best time to visit Matheson Wetlands Preserve - Main Pond & Boardwalk for birding?▼
The best months to visit Matheson Wetlands Preserve - Main Pond & Boardwalk for birding are June-October. The best seasons are Summer and Fall.
What birds can I see at Matheson Wetlands Preserve - Main Pond & Boardwalk?▼
Notable species at Matheson Wetlands Preserve - Main Pond & Boardwalk include Canada Goose, Sandhill Crane, Northern Harrier, Red-tailed Hawk, Northern Flicker. The area supports lake habitats.
How difficult is birding at Matheson Wetlands Preserve - Main Pond & Boardwalk?▼
Birding at Matheson Wetlands Preserve - Main Pond & Boardwalk is rated as Easy. The trails and viewing areas are accessible for birders of all experience levels.
What amenities are available at Matheson Wetlands Preserve - Main Pond & Boardwalk?▼
Matheson Wetlands Preserve - Main Pond & Boardwalk offers the following amenities: Parking, Restrooms, Trails, Visitor Center.
